Red Bull’s Max Verstappen has won his fourth consecutive Emilia Romagna Grand Prix at Imola in Italy.

The victory was the 65th of Verstappen’s career, second of the season and the four times world champion’s fourth in a row at the Italian circuit near Bologna after wins in 2021, 2022 and 2024.

There was no race in 2023 due to flooding.

Verstappen finished six seconds ahead of the McLarens of Lando Norris and Oscar Piastri, who were second and third.

The Ferrari’s of Lewis Hamilton and Charles Leclerc finished fourth and sixth, with Williams’ Alex Albon in fifth place.

The result reduces Piastri’s championship lead over Norris to 13 points, with Verstappen trailing Norris by nine.

The crews and drivers will now shift their focus to Monaco, in the second race of the European triple-header, after which the Spanish Grand Prix will take place in Barcelona.
